自2008年10月22日Android系统发布以来,其内置的浏览器Google Chrome Lite迅速成为Linux平台上首款稳定运行的WebKit浏览器。截至2009年3月,Chrome Lite在Linux系统中的表现尤为突出,为用户提供了流畅的浏览体验。本文将探讨Chrome Lite在Linux平台上的发展历程及其技术特点,并通过丰富的代码示例增强文章的实用性和可读性。
Android系统, Chrome Lite, Linux平台, WebKit浏览器, 代码示例
在2008年的秋天,当Android系统首次亮相之时,它不仅带来了智能手机操作系统的革新,还伴随着对浏览器性能的全新期待。彼时,随着移动互联网的兴起,用户对于手机浏览器的需求日益增长——不仅要快速、稳定,还要兼容各种网页标准。正是在这种背景下,Google Chrome Lite应运而生,它不仅满足了Android系统对于浏览器的基本需求,更是在Linux平台上展现出了前所未有的潜力。
对于Android系统而言,内置一款高效且稳定的浏览器至关重要。Chrome Lite作为Android系统的一部分,从一开始就肩负着提升用户体验的重要使命。它不仅需要支持HTML5等新兴网络技术,还要确保在不同设备上都能保持一致的性能表现。更重要的是,Chrome Lite必须能够无缝集成到Android生态系统中,为用户提供流畅无阻的上网体验。
Chrome Lite之所以能在Linux平台上取得成功,很大程度上得益于其基于WebKit内核这一事实。WebKit是一个开源的渲染引擎,它不仅拥有强大的功能,而且在开发灵活性方面也颇具优势。这使得Chrome Lite能够轻松地适应Linux环境,并展现出卓越的表现。
WebKit的核心优势在于其对Web标准的支持程度。它能够很好地处理HTML、CSS以及JavaScript等现代网页技术,这意味着开发者可以利用这些技术创建出丰富多样的网页应用。此外,WebKit还具备出色的跨平台能力,这意味着Chrome Lite可以在多种操作系统上实现一致的用户体验,这对于Android系统来说尤为重要。
更值得一提的是,WebKit的开源特性鼓励了社区的积极参与和技术改进。随着时间的推移,WebKit不断进化,引入了许多创新功能,如离线存储、地理位置服务等,这些都极大地丰富了Chrome Lite的功能集,使其成为了一款极具竞争力的浏览器。
2008年10月22日,一个不平凡的日子,Android系统携带着它的梦想与承诺来到了这个世界。与此同时,一款名为Chrome Lite的浏览器也随之诞生,它不仅是Android系统的一部分,更是Linux平台上首款稳定运行的WebKit浏览器。这一刻,标志着移动互联网的新篇章正式拉开序幕。
当初,Google团队面临着巨大的挑战:如何在资源有限的移动设备上提供媲美桌面端的浏览体验?他们深知,要实现这一目标,就必须从零开始打造一款全新的浏览器。于是,Chrome Lite应运而生。它不仅继承了Google Chrome浏览器的优秀基因,还针对移动设备进行了优化,确保即使在低配置的设备上也能流畅运行。
Chrome Lite的诞生并非偶然,它是Google工程师们智慧与汗水的结晶。在那个时代,移动浏览器市场尚未成熟,许多技术难题亟待解决。然而,凭借着对未来的坚定信念和不懈努力,Google团队最终克服了重重困难,让Chrome Lite成为了现实。这款浏览器不仅填补了Linux平台上稳定WebKit浏览器的空白,更为后来者树立了标杆。
Chrome Lite不仅仅是一款浏览器,它更是一种理念的体现。从设计之初,Google就致力于让它成为一款轻量级、高性能的产品。以下是Chrome Lite最为显著的几个特点:
- **轻量化设计**:考虑到移动设备的硬件限制,Chrome Lite采用了轻量化的设计理念,确保即使在资源有限的情况下也能提供流畅的浏览体验。
- **WebKit内核**:作为首款基于WebKit内核的浏览器,Chrome Lite充分利用了WebKit的强大功能,支持最新的Web标准,如HTML5、CSS3等,为用户带来更加丰富多样的网页体验。
- **跨平台兼容性**:得益于WebKit的跨平台特性,Chrome Lite能够在不同的操作系统上保持一致的表现,无论是在Android还是其他Linux发行版上,用户都能享受到相同的高质量浏览体验。
- **社区支持**:由于WebKit是开源项目,Chrome Lite能够受益于全球开发者社区的贡献和支持。随着时间的推移,它不断吸收新的技术和功能,变得更加完善。
Chrome Lite的出现,不仅改变了Linux平台上的浏览器格局,也为整个移动互联网行业注入了新的活力。它证明了即使是资源受限的移动设备,也能享受到与桌面端媲美的浏览体验。
在2008年那个充满变革的时代,Linux平台正经历着一场技术革命。随着Android系统的横空出世,Linux平台迎来了前所未有的机遇与挑战。彼时,Linux用户对于浏览器的需求不再仅仅局限于基本的网页浏览功能,而是渴望获得更加流畅、稳定且功能丰富的上网体验。Chrome Lite的出现恰逢其时,它不仅满足了Linux平台对于浏览器的基本需求,更是在技术层面实现了突破性的进展。
在Linux平台上,用户对于浏览器的要求越来越高。一方面,随着Web技术的飞速发展,用户希望浏览器能够支持最新的Web标准,如HTML5、CSS3等,以便能够访问到更加丰富多彩的网页内容。另一方面,考虑到Linux平台的多样性,用户也希望浏览器能够在不同的Linux发行版上保持一致的性能表现。此外,随着移动互联网的兴起,越来越多的用户开始使用移动设备访问互联网,这就要求浏览器不仅要在桌面环境中表现出色,在移动设备上也要能够提供流畅的浏览体验。
在这样的背景下,Chrome Lite凭借其轻量化的设计、强大的WebKit内核以及优秀的跨平台兼容性,迅速成为了Linux平台上最受欢迎的浏览器之一。它不仅填补了Linux平台上稳定WebKit浏览器的空白,更为用户带来了前所未有的上网体验。
Chrome Lite之所以能够在Linux平台上取得成功,除了其出色的技术特点之外,还在于它深刻理解并满足了Linux用户的实际需求。以下是Chrome Lite在Linux平台上的几大优势:
- **轻量化设计**:考虑到Linux平台多样化的硬件配置,Chrome Lite采用了轻量化的设计理念,确保即使在资源有限的设备上也能提供流畅的浏览体验。这种设计不仅减少了内存占用,还提高了浏览器的整体响应速度,让用户在浏览网页时感受到更加顺畅的操作体验。
- **强大的WebKit内核**:作为首款基于WebKit内核的浏览器,Chrome Lite充分利用了WebKit的强大功能,支持最新的Web标准,如HTML5、CSS3等,为用户带来更加丰富多样的网页体验。这意味着用户可以在Chrome Lite中访问到那些采用最新技术制作的网站,享受更加沉浸式的上网体验。
- **优秀的跨平台兼容性**:得益于WebKit的跨平台特性,Chrome Lite能够在不同的操作系统上保持一致的表现,无论是在Android还是其他Linux发行版上,用户都能享受到相同的高质量浏览体验。这种一致性不仅提升了用户的满意度,也为开发者提供了更加友好的开发环境。
- **社区支持与持续改进**:由于WebKit是开源项目,Chrome Lite能够受益于全球开发者社区的贡献和支持。随着时间的推移,它不断吸收新的技术和功能,变得更加完善。这种持续的改进不仅提升了浏览器的性能,还增强了其安全性,让用户在享受便捷上网的同时,也能得到更好的保护。
Chrome Lite的出现,不仅改变了Linux平台上的浏览器格局,更为整个移动互联网行业注入了新的活力。它证明了即使是资源受限的移动设备,也能享受到与桌面端媲美的浏览体验。
在深入了解Chrome Lite的技术细节之后,我们不妨通过一些具体的代码示例来进一步探索这款浏览器在Linux平台上的应用方式。下面是一些简单的示例,旨在展示如何利用Chrome Lite的WebKit内核来实现特定的功能。
**示例1:HTML5 Canvas绘图**
```html
<!DOCTYPE html>
<html>
<head>
<title>Canvas Drawing Example</title>
</head>
<body>
<canvas id="myCanvas" width="500" height="500"></canvas>
<script>
var canvas = document.getElementById('myCanvas');
var ctx = canvas.getContext('2d');
ctx.fillStyle = 'red';
ctx.fillRect(20, 20, 100, 100);
</script>
</body>
</html>
```
这段代码展示了如何使用HTML5的`<canvas>`元素在Chrome Lite中绘制一个红色的矩形。得益于WebKit内核的强大支持,这段代码可以在Chrome Lite中完美运行,为用户带来流畅的视觉体验。
**示例2:使用CSS3动画**
```html
<!DOCTYPE html>
<html>
<head>
<title>CSS3 Animation Example</title>
<style>
#box {
width: 100px;
height: 100px;
background-color: blue;
animation-name: spin;
animation-duration: 2s;
animation-iteration-count: infinite;
}
@keyframes spin {
from { transform: rotate(0deg); }
to { transform: rotate(360deg); }
}
</style>
</head>
<body>
<div id="box"></div>
</body>
</html>
```
上述代码演示了如何使用CSS3动画来创建一个旋转的蓝色方块。Chrome Lite的WebKit内核能够平滑地执行这些动画效果,为用户带来更加生动的网页体验。
通过这些示例,我们可以看到Chrome Lite在处理HTML5和CSS3等现代Web技术方面的强大能力。这些技术的应用不仅丰富了网页的内容,也为开发者提供了更多的创意空间。
自2008年10月22日Android系统发布以来,Chrome Lite作为Linux平台上首款稳定的WebKit浏览器,已经在多个方面取得了显著的成绩。以下是一些具体的实践案例,展示了Chrome Lite如何在Linux平台上发挥其优势。
**案例1:教育领域的应用**
在教育领域,Chrome Lite被广泛应用于在线学习平台。由于其轻量化的设计和对HTML5的支持,学生可以通过Chrome Lite轻松访问各种多媒体教学资源,如视频教程、互动式课程等。这不仅提高了学习效率,还为教师提供了更加丰富的教学工具。
**案例2:企业办公场景**
在企业办公环境中,Chrome Lite同样表现出色。它能够支持各种企业级应用和服务,如云文档编辑、在线会议等。得益于其强大的跨平台兼容性,员工无论是在台式机还是移动设备上,都能享受到一致的工作体验。此外,Chrome Lite的安全特性也为企业数据提供了坚实的保障。
**案例3:社区支持与反馈**
Chrome Lite的成功离不开活跃的开发者社区。通过GitHub等平台,开发者们积极贡献代码、修复漏洞,并分享最佳实践。这种开放的合作模式促进了Chrome Lite的持续改进和发展。同时,用户也可以通过官方论坛等方式提供反馈,帮助团队更好地了解用户需求,从而不断优化产品。
通过这些实践案例,我们可以清晰地看到Chrome Lite在Linux平台上所发挥的作用。它不仅为用户带来了流畅的浏览体验,还推动了整个Linux生态系统的进步。
自2008年10月22日Android系统发布以来,Chrome Lite作为其内置浏览器,不仅迅速成为了Linux平台上首款稳定运行的WebKit浏览器,还在2009年3月时展现出了卓越的表现。通过轻量化设计、强大的WebKit内核以及优秀的跨平台兼容性,Chrome Lite不仅满足了Linux用户对于浏览器的基本需求,还为他们带来了流畅、稳定且功能丰富的上网体验。尤其是在教育领域和企业办公场景中,Chrome Lite的应用极大地提升了工作效率和学习质量。此外,活跃的开发者社区为Chrome Lite提供了持续的技术支持和改进,确保了其在Linux平台上的领先地位。总而言之,Chrome Lite不仅改变了Linux平台上的浏览器格局,更为整个移动互联网行业的发展注入了新的活力。